5.0 out of 5 stars Great ice house!, January 2, 2012
This review is from: ClamŽ Base Camp Thermal 6x6' Hub Pop - Up Icefishing Shelter (Misc.)
Received this as a 2011 Christmas gift. I have been out with it 4 times in the last week and it is really a great shelter. I toyed with exchanging it for the Clam Yukon or Nanook that have seats attached to the sled, but after looking at this one set up in the store, I am glad I kept it. It pops up literally in about a minute and is warm within 5 minutes with a Buddy heater and stays warm and comfortable with the heater set on "low." The house is plenty big for 3 people to fish, and if need be, you can squeeze in 4 to fish. This is where it beats the Yukon type house, hands down. In the other style house, you don't have the room to fish more than 2 people, plus the ceiling height is 84" in the Base Camp, plenty high to stand and stretch without hitting your head. Another plus is that it comes with a storage duffel bag and weighs only 38 pounds. The 2 man Yukon or Nanook both weigh about 85 pounds and don't have the head room this one does. I can put this duffel bag in the back of my Tahoe along with heater, chairs, vexilar, auger, etc. and have some room to spare. We were out this afternoon in 4 degree weather with a strong wind and were fishing in sweatshirts inside the Base Camp. Enjoy!
